Heads up, night crew: the landlord's team from Oakmere Estates is doing a site audit next week, likely between 22:00 and 02:00. They'll check fire doors, exit signage, and the plant room — just let them get on with it and note their visit in the log. Keep corridors clear of pallets beforehand. If they need the plant room, use the access code below.

staff pass of kawip-hawef = bdg-QLP-2

## Changed defaults — Larkspindle search relevance

Relevance tuning notes moved from per-index overrides to global defaults. BM25 k1 lowered, field boosts normalized, synonym expansion now off by default (was on). Security note: tuning endpoint no longer accepts unauthenticated reads; audit log retention extended to 90 days. No query rewriting occurs client-side. All changes took effect in release 4.2. The effective default configuration is listed below.

deployment values, bahof-badug:
[rusix]
team = zorok
access_code = ac_641cbe
owner = ulair.tamius
host = rusix.torvasoft.local
port = 5672
peer = ulaix.sivrelworks.internal
salt = 1df570ed
pin = 6327

**Alert: TraceGapDetected**

This alert fires when Spanlark detects requests crossing the Orbitally checkout microservices without a propagated trace ID, indicating broken instrumentation or a misconfigured gateway. Support should note the affected service pair from the alert payload and check recent deploys. If the gap persists beyond 30 minutes, escalate to the observability team at the address below.

alerts address for bajop-yahog: istwyn@lumiclabs.internal

### Undo/Redo Recovery — Plottwist Editor

If undo/redo history desyncs after a hotfix deploy, flush the history cache before reopening affected diagrams. Do not restart the editor pods first; that orphans pending redo stacks. Flush via the admin CLI, then verify the history depth counter resets to zero. The flush command authenticates against the Histkeeper service. Use the key below when prompted.

API key for yafof-bagef: vxb7-jBBsZhX